Answer: In a ring topology, the unplugging of a single station may affect all network’s performance significantly and even make the whole system dysfunctional. In ring networks, the stations pass data to each other sequentially until the last station delivers the information to its destination. If one station is unplugged in a ring topology, it breaks the circuit, causing communication failure throughout the network.

To address this issue, prompt identification and rectification are crucial:

  • Identification: Within a shortest period of time, pinpoint which station has been unplugged. This may demand physical investigation or use of network monitoring tools, to fix the disconnected node easily.
  • Reconnection: After the unplugged station is found, it should be connected to the network in a quick manner. Verifying all connections are properly connected and secure is key to avoid further disruptions.
  • Network Restoration: Following the re-connection the network should automatically start normal operation. Yet if the disruptions continue, the manual interference may be needed in order to reset the network devices or tackle underlying issues.
  • Preventative Measures: Initiate measures that will reduce adverse effects in future occurrences. Checking hardware, creating safe connections and putting in redundancy or failover procedures will assist in maintaining network stability.
